如何利用实现用户身份安全验证
一、痛点分析:为何实名认证及身份证核验成为必须
随着互联网业务的高速发展,用户规模不断扩大,线上身份信息的安全性和真实性成为企业亟需解决的核心问题。传统的人工身份核验,面临诸多挑战:高成本、低效率、易出错。尤其是在金融、电商、共享出行及在线教育等多个行业,用户身份的准确验证直接关联到平台的合规性与风控能力。
例如,许多平台在用户注册时,因缺乏有效的实名认证机制,导致虚假账户泛滥,给业务安全带来巨大隐患。此外,监管部门对用户身份信息安全的管控日趋严格,不合规的身份验证流程可能导致业务被叫停或遭受罚款。综上可见,一个高效、准确且便捷的实名认证流程,成为平台提升用户体验与保障业务安全的关键环节。
二、解决方案:基于实名认证流程及身份证核验API接口的完整方案
针对上述痛点,本文将以实名认证流程详解及身份证核验API接口的接入为核心,为企业搭建一个标准化、自动化的身份验证体系。该方案充分利用现有身份证信息核验技术,整合多维度身份检查,既提升核验准确率,又优化用户注册体验。
核心内容包括:
- 实名认证的业务场景分析与流程设计。
- 身份证核验API接口的技术细节及接口调用方式。
- 系统架构与数据安全保障措施。
- 接入过程中可能遇到的问题及应对策略。
1. 业务场景及实名认证流程设计
实名认证的基本目标是确认用户提供的姓名和身份证号是否真实有效,保证用户身份的独一无二。业务流程大致分为:
- 用户注册或登录时提交姓名和身份证号。
- 系统发起身份证核验请求,调用API接口。
- API返回核验结果,包括真实性及风险提示。
- 系统根据结果决定是否允许用户完成注册或登录。
在部分场景,还可以结合活体检测、人脸识别等技术,进一步提升身份验证的可靠性与安全性。
2. 身份证核验API接口介绍及接入方式
身份证核验API通常由第三方数据服务商提供,基于公安权威数据库对用户提供的身份信息进行实时验证。关键技术点包括:
- 数据准确性:接口链接权威身份信息库,确保返回数据的真实性。
- 请求稳定性与响应速度:高并发情况下保证接口响应正常,避免验证延迟。
- 安全性:通过HTTPS加密请求,采用鉴权机制防止非法调用。
接入步骤一般如下:
- 注册并申请API权限,获取AppKey和AppSecret。
- 根据API文档准备调用参数,包括身份证号、姓名等信息。
- 调用接口,解析返回的JSON或XML数据。
- 根据验证结果调整业务逻辑(如通过/不通过处理)。
下方为示例代码(以伪代码示范):
参数 = {
"idNumber": "110101199003071234",
"name": "张三"
}
请求头 = {
"Authorization": "Bearer {token}",
"Content-Type": "application/json"
}
响应 = 调用身份证核验API(参数, 请求头)
if (响应.code == 200 and 响应.data.status == "valid") {
允许注册
} else {
拒绝注册("身份信息不匹配")
}
3. 系统设计和数据安全保障
实名认证数据属于敏感个人信息,企业必须严格遵守国家关于个人信息保护的法律法规,落实以下安全措施:
- 传输层采用HTTPS确保数据加密。
- API密钥和凭证采取安全管理,防止泄露。
- 数据库中存储的身份证信息应加密保存,限制访问权限。
- 日志记录审核,确保身份验证流程合规且可追溯。
- 定期进行安全演练与漏洞扫描,防范潜在风险。
4. 接入过程中的常见问题及解决方法
在与身份证核验API对接过程中,可能遇到以下问题:
- 接口响应延迟:建议增加重试机制,并通过合理负载均衡减少等待时间。
- 身份信息不匹配:提醒用户核对输入信息,或增加身份补充验证环节。
- 接口访问权限被拒:确认密钥权限及调用频率限制,调整请求策略。
- 数据格式不符:统一请求及响应格式,做好异常处理和兼容性测试。
三、步骤详解:如何一步步完成实名认证API的接入
以下内容分阶段详细说明实现过程,指导企业或开发者顺利完成接入。
步骤一:需求确认与方案评估
明确业务需要核验身份的具体环节(注册、支付、提现等),评估API供应商的可信度和服务水平,选择合适的身份证核验接口。同时制定身份验证的规则和用户体验标准。
步骤二:申请接口权限并获取密钥
在选定供应商平台上注册账户,提交资质调研,完成实名认证,获得API访问的AppKey、AppSecret等参数,相关管理账号信息以备后续调用。
步骤三:搭建测试环境与接口联调
开发团队在测试环境实现接口调用,使用供应商提供的模拟数据,验证请求的正确性和接口的稳定性。同时关注异常处理逻辑,确保在网络异常、数据异常时系统可自我恢复。
步骤四:完善业务流程及用户体验
根据接口验证结果,设计合理的提示和反馈机制,比如身份信息不一致时引导用户重新输入,或提供人工审核途径。确保整个流程简洁流畅,避免用户流失。
步骤五:上线部署与安全加固
完成接口集成后部署到生产环境,结合安全策略进行加固,定期监控接口调用情况,监测异常数据或可疑行为。强化日志分析和身份验证风险评估。
四、效果预期:通过标准化实名认证流程提升业务竞争力
成功接入身份证核验API的实名认证流程,为企业和用户带来可衡量的积极效果:
- 身份信息精准无误:大幅降低欺诈账户,防止虚假身份带来的经济损失和法律风险。
- 提升用户信任度:用户知晓平台严格身份认证,增强平台的权威感及安全感。
- 流程自动化简捷高效:替代传统人工核验,提高效率,缩短验证时间,优化用户注册体验。
- 合规监管要求满足:符合国家相关法律法规关于用户身份信息管理的要求,确保业务顺利开展。
- 数据安全体系完善:个人隐私保护到位,避免泄密事件,维护企业品牌声誉。
未来,随着技术的进一步发展,实名认证结合区块链、人工智能等手段,将实现更为智能和可信的身份验证体系,推动数字经济环境下的安全升级。
总结
实名认证流程和身份证核验API的接入,是保障互联网业务安全不可或缺的环节。通过科学设计流程,合理利用权威API接口,企业不仅保障了用户身份的真实性,也提高了整体业务效率和用户满意度。希望本文详尽的痛点分析、解决方案和实操步骤,能够帮助大家快速构建完善的实名认证体系,为业务发展筑牢安全防线。
评论区
欢迎发表您的看法和建议
暂无评论,快来抢沙发吧!